The Washington Redskins, who are looking for reasons not to select Kellen Winslow, II, with the fifth overall pick in the draft given his decision to sign with the Poston brothers, found more ammo for their likely decision to shy away from the former Miami Hurricane earlier this week.
A league source tells us that Winslow's visit to the Redskins was a major disappointment.
Winslow, per the source, was late for meetings -- including his meeting with head coach Joe Gibbs. We're told that Winslow otherwise was unimpressive in his sessions with the powers-that-be.
This development will do little to prompt the Redskins to overlook Winslow's choice of the Postons as his agents. The Postons are on the outs with the 'Skins given their allegations that the team scuh-rewed linebacker LaVar Arrington out of $6.5 million in his December 2003 contract extension.
